What Are Trigger Point Injections

Ever had a sore, painful knot in your muscle? If so, then you’ve dealt with a trigger point before. You may massage the knot hoping that it will ease up and go away; unfortunately, simply rubbing the knotted muscles probably won’t be enough to ease your pain. Trigger points form when muscles tense up and can’t relax. When this happens our medical professionals offer trigger point injections that help to reduce inflammation while helping the muscles release.

When are trigger point injections useful?

Trigger point injections can be used to alleviate muscle pain just about anywhere in the body (we most commonly treat the back, neck, and legs). Trigger point injections can also be a great way to treat,

  • Tension headaches
  • Fibromyalgia
  • Myofascial pain

How does a trigger point injection work?

When a knot develops in the muscle this causes intense pain that flare-ups with activity. When the muscles aren’t able to relax on their own, trigger point injections are used by our medical team to help release tight, tense, and even spasming muscles to reduce inflammation and pain. Trigger point injections contain different kinds of medications to help alleviate muscle pain depending on the severity and the symptoms you are experiencing. Trigger point injections may include,

  • Lidocaine or a local anesthetic to numb the area

In cases where the patient is dealing with trigger points within deeper tissue, dry needling may be a better option since this can target deeper tissues to alleviate myofascial trigger points and provide better relief.

When will I experience relief? How long will the relief last?

It only takes about 15 minutes to administer the injections. Most patients will experience some degree of relief immediately after treatment, but it takes about 2-3 days to see the final results of the treatment. Some people may experience weeks or even months of relief after a single round of trigger point injections. Trigger point injections are also combined with other medical clinic treatments and therapies such as massage, acupuncture, stretching exercises, and physical therapy.
